About Trusts Law in Cayman Islands

In the Cayman Islands, trusts are a common legal structure used for estate and wealth management. A trust is created when a person (the settlor) transfers assets to a trustee, who holds and manages those assets for the benefit of beneficiaries. The Cayman Islands has a robust and well-established legal framework for trusts, making it a popular jurisdiction for setting up trusts.

Local Laws Overview

In the Cayman Islands, trusts are primarily governed by the Trusts Law (2011 Revision) and common law principles. Key aspects of local laws relating to trusts include the requirement for a trust deed, the duties and powers of trustees, the rights of beneficiaries, and the jurisdiction's favorable tax regime for trusts.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is a trust?

A trust is a legal arrangement where a person (the settlor) transfers assets to a trustee, who holds and manages those assets for the benefit of beneficiaries.

2. Who can be a trustee?

A trustee can be an individual or a corporate entity, and they have a legal obligation to administer the trust according to its terms and in the best interests of the beneficiaries.

3. What are the benefits of setting up a trust in the Cayman Islands?

The Cayman Islands offer a stable legal framework, confidentiality, tax advantages, and access to professional trust services, making it an attractive jurisdiction for setting up a trust.

4. How can I amend a trust?

To amend a trust, you typically need to follow the procedures outlined in the trust deed, which may require the consent of the settlor, trustee, and beneficiaries.

5. What are the duties of a trustee?

A trustee has a duty to act in good faith, prudently manage trust assets, avoid conflicts of interest, and act in the best interests of the beneficiaries.

6. Can a trustee be removed?

In certain circumstances, such as misconduct or incapacity, a trustee can be removed by the court or in accordance with the trust deed.

7. How are trusts taxed in the Cayman Islands?

Trusts in the Cayman Islands are generally not subject to local taxes on income, capital gains, or wealth, making it an advantageous jurisdiction for tax planning.

8. What is the role of a protector in a trust?

A protector is a third party appointed to oversee the trustee's actions and ensure that the trust is managed in accordance with the settlor's wishes.

9. Can I create a charitable trust in the Cayman Islands?

Yes, the Cayman Islands allow for the creation of charitable trusts, which are used for philanthropic purposes and can provide tax benefits for the settlor.
